Understanding Leadwork: The Unsung Hero of Your Kirkby Roof

You might not always notice it, but leadwork plays an essential role in the integrity of your roof. It's the flexible, durable material used to create watertight seals around vulnerable areas like chimneys, dormer windows, roof valleys, and where a roof meets a wall. Without expert leadwork, water can easily sneak into your home, causing significant damage. In Kirkby, where our homes face plenty of rain and wind, having correctly installed and maintained lead is absolutely crucial for long-lasting protection. It’s an industry standard for a reason!

Is Your Leadwork Failing? Signs to Watch Out for in Kirkby

Leadwork is tough, but even the best can show signs of wear over time. Knowing what to look for can help you prevent costly repairs down the line. Keep an eye out for visible cracks or tears in the lead, especially where it bends or joins. If you see lead lifting or buckling, or if you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, these are clear indicators that your leadwork may be failing. Ignoring these early signs can quickly lead to bigger problems, so getting them checked swiftly by a professional is key.

The Enduring Advantages of Lead: A Smart & Lasting Investment for Your Roof

Lead has been a favourite roofing material for centuries, and for good reason. It’s incredibly durable, offering a lifespan that often exceeds 60 years when installed correctly – far longer than many alternative materials. Its natural flexibility means it can adapt to your roof's movements with temperature changes without cracking, unlike some other materials. Plus, lead is 100% recyclable, making it an environmentally responsible choice. What Exactly is Leadwork on My Roof and Why is it Important?

+

Leadwork in roofing mainly refers to the lead flashing that you see on different parts of your roof. Think of it as a super-flexible, waterproof seal. You'll often spot it around chimneys, in roof valleys where two slopes meet, around skylights or dormer windows, and where extensions join the main building. Its job is crucial: it bridges gaps and changes in direction on your roof, stopping rainwater from getting in. Because lead is so malleable, it can be shaped to form a tight, long-lasting barrier, which is really important for a weatherproof roof. Without proper leadwork, water would just pour into your home in these vulnerable areas.

Why Do Roofs Need Lead Flashing and How Does it Protect My Home?

+

Your roof needs lead flashing because not every part of it can be perfectly sealed with just tiles or slates. Where different sections of your roof meet, or where structures like chimneys come through, there are natural gaps. Lead flashing is expertly cut and shaped to fit these tricky spots, creating a durable and flexible seal. This means no matter how much it rains or how strong the wind blows, water simply can't find its way into your property. It's a key part of your home's defence against the elements, significantly extending the life of your roof and protecting the inside of your home from damp.

When Should I Worry About My Roof's Leadwork? Signs of Trouble.

+

Keep an eye out for a few common signs that your leadwork might need some attention. If you see it looking cracked, buckled, or visibly lifted – especially after strong winds – that's a red flag. Sometimes, you might even notice a grey or white staining on the masonry below your lead, which suggests water is running over it incorrectly. Of course, the most obvious sign of trouble is any sign of a leak inside your home, particularly around chimneys or in loft areas. Don't let a small issue turn into a bigger, more costly repair. If you spot any of these, it's definitely time to get a professional to have a look.

How Long Does Quality Leadwork Generally Last on a Roof?

+

One of the best things about leadwork is how incredibly durable it is. When it's properly installed by experienced roofers, high-quality lead flashing can generally last a very long time – often 60 to 100 years, or even longer! Its longevity is one of the reasons it's been a standard roofing material for centuries.
